Dorothy Prince's Obituary
Dorothy Fay (Hasten) Prince, age 90, went to be with the Lord on April 21, 2019 at Haven Care Nursing Home in Longview. She is rejoicing in Heaven with her parents, William and Annie Mae Hasten, and her two daughters, Theodora (Teddy) Prince and Faye Ann White.
Dorothy was born on May 24, 1928 in Mineola, Texas to William Rufus and Annie Mae (Hoskins) Hasten. Dorothy, known as Nanny, to her grandchildren, was a devoted and loving mother, sister, daughter, and grandmother. She attended grade school in Hainesville, Texas, and attended High School in Mineola, Texas. Her love for her family was profound and was evident through the degree of her actions. Dorothy raised three daughters by working long hours as a seamstress and was the sole caretaker of her elderly mother later in life. Sacrificing for her family was a motif expressed throughout her life. Most importantly, Dorothy was a Christian that loved her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.
She is survived by her sister, Dolly Krodell and husband Floyd of Garland, Texas; her daughter, Peggy Collins and husband Jimmy of Longview, Texas; grandchildren Chris Rogers of Longview, John Collins and wife Mary of Schertz, Texas, Matthew Collins and Justin Collins of Longview; great-grandchildren, Lincoln and Lorelei Collins of Schertz, Texas, Kayla Coppedge and husband Cameron of Longview; great-great-grandchildren, Isabella, Blayze, Gabriella, & Maverick Coppedge; nephews, Dolan Krodell and wife Dianna of Pottsboro, Texas and much more extended family.
